The crash occurred around 4 a.m. at Oak Drive and Riverview Avenue in Seminole County. 

Troopers said the Hyundai was traveling northbound on Oak Drive, when for an unknown reason, the vehicle drove off the roadway and traveled into the wooded area. 

The vehicle ended up hitting a tree and killing the driver, Haneefah Miller, 38. The passenger, Leroy Gray, 29, was transported to Central Florida Regional Hospital in serious condition. Both are from Deltona, Fl. 

According to the report, it is unknown at this time if alcohol played a factor in the crash. 

The crash remains under investigation.
